Thermal degradation of 1,2-bis(dichloroboryl)ethane gives low yields of a white solid (BCl)6(CH)4 which has a hexaboro-adamantane structure. Substitution of the chlorine atoms by bromine or methyl occurs on treatment with BBr3 and Sn(CH3)4, respectively.
